Step 1: Locate the Leak

Our team starts by finding the exact source of the leak. We use moisture readings and visual checks to confirm where the water is coming from. This step is crucial. If we miss the source, the problem will come back. We work quickly to isolate the area and prevent further damage. You don’t want to wait for the water to spread. Get it fixed right the first time.

Step 2: Remove Standing Water

We use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ove any water that has pooled on the floor. This step is fast but thorough. We don’t just take the water away. We make sure the area is dry enough to start the next steps. You’ll see the difference right away. No more puddles, no more dampness. The water is gone, and the next steps can begin.

Step 3: Dry the Affected Area

We bring in industrial air movers and dehumidifiers to dry the space. We monitor the area constantly to make sure the moisture levels drop to safe levels. This step can take 2-3 days, depending on the size of the leak. We stay until the job is done. You don’t want to rush this part. The right drying process is the key to a full recovery.

Step 4: Clean and Sanitize

Once the area is dry, we clean and sanitize all surfaces. We use EPA-approved products to remove any bacteria or mold spores. This step is just as important as the drying.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al Cost In Springtown, TX

Costs for Ice Maker Line Leak Water Removal vary based on the size of the leak, how long it’s been leaking, and the extent of the damage. These are general estimates. Your actual cost will depend on your specific situation. Call us for a free estimate. You’ll get a clear breakdown of what to expect.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Leak Detection & Isolation $150 – $350 Size of the area and complexity of the leak.
Water Removal $200 – $500 Amount of water and how quickly it’s removed.
Drying & Dehumidification $300 – $700 Duration of drying and level of moisture.
Surface Cleaning & Sanitization $100 – $250 Amount of affected area and level of contamination.
Material Replacement $200 – $600 Extent of damage and type of materials needed.
Final Inspection & Restoration $150 – $400 Complexity of the repair and final checks required.

How do you find a leaking ice maker line?

We use moisture meters and thermal imaging to locate the leak. We check the area around the fridge and under the floor. We look for signs of water damage and unusual odors. It’s a detailed process. We don’t just take a guess. We find the exact source. That way, we can fix it properly. You need the right solution.

Can I prevent ice maker line leaks?

Yes, regular maintenance helps. Check the connections and look for signs of wear. Replace old lines before they fail. It’s a small step that can save you a lot of trouble.
